Jonathan co-starred in the British version of the television show <em>Candid Camera</em> (1960-67) and co-starred with Germaine Greer and Kenny Everett in <em>Nice Time</em>. He published a number of humorous books, painted for many years, and exhibited regularly in Jamaica, Italy and the United States.  He is survived by his wife , Shelagh and  two sons from his first marriage, Christian, who lives in  Barcelona, Spain, and Jonathan, who lives in Frankfurt, Germany.</p>
<p>Jonathan Routh wintered at Fort Victoria, Tryall Club, Sandy Bay in the parish of Hanover, Jamaica, West Indies and also spent summers in Nacolina, Conco Doro, Castellina in Chianti, and Sienna, Italy.</p>

<p>A set of four hand-coloured intaglio aquatint &#8216;American Polo Scene&#8217; prints by the American artist, Paul Brown, titled &#8216;On the Boards&#8217;, &#8216;The Save&#8217;, &#8216;The Goal&#8217; and &#8216;Down the Field&#8217;; each signed to the lower left. Dimensions of each 24 x 17 inches (61 x 43 cm). Plate size: 12.5 x 20 inches. Printed on imported handmade paper. Titles engraved in the same style as other sets of American Sporting scenes published by The Derrydale Press, 1930.  Only 175 signed proofs were produced of each print, which makes a bona fide set of four rare and valuable.</p>

<p>The Marblehead Bracelet, inspired by the cotton Turk&#8217;s-head bracelet, is made of thousands of tiny pearls, tightly woven together, and clasped with a fourteen karat gold safety clasp. It took nearly two years to develop and perfect the construction technique for the Marblehead Bracelet.</p>
<p><img src='http://chisholmgallery.com/new/wp-content/uploads/2008/02/clasp.jpg' alt='Marblehead Bracelet clasp' /></p>
<p>Few places in the world have more sailing tradition than does Marblehead, Massachusetts, the Yachting Capital of America and the birthplace of the American Navy.</p>
<p>The Marblehead Bracelet reflects those traditions in its twelve strands of pearls and Turk&#8217;s-head knotting and, it is a tribute to the wonderful people of Marblehead, who were so kind and supportive of the designer, during her many years there.</p>
<p>Andréa Witherwax is the creator of the Marblehead Bracelet.</p>

<p><strong>Sporting Art and Landscape Periods<br />
</strong>Like the great horse painters George Stubbs and Frederic Remington, Jenness Cortez is first and foremost an extraordinary draftsman. Beginning in 1977, and for the next twenty years, she received international acclaim for her sporting paintings and her powerful depictions of the horse. During the mid 1990s, her long-time interest in landscape began to blossom. In the tradition of the 19th century Hudson River and Barbizon School painters, her vision comprehends all of nature as a manifestation of the divine. Cortez&#8217;s landscape images evoke a certain transcendent quality rarely seen in contemporary realism. Her representations of the phenomenal world are sensitive, passionate and deeply moving. </p>
<p>Cortez&#8217;s clients are knowledgeable and include important collectors known for their ability to choose artists whose careers become legendary. Her work is in numerous public and private collections including those of Presidents Ronald Reagan and Bill Clinton, HRH Queen Elizabeth, II, Mr. and Mrs. Edward Alexander, Mr. Edgar Bronfman, Ms. Virginia Kraft Payson, Ambassador True Davis, Mr. Henry Kravis, Mr. Ogden Mills Phipps, Mrs. Cornelius Vanderbilt Whitney, Congressman Gerald Solomon, Gov. George Pataki, Gov. Hugh Carey, Atlanta Braves general manager John Schuerholz and Mr. Jerry Weintraub. Public and corporate collectors include the New York State Museum, Fluor Corporation, Saratoga Harness, Inc., Skidmore College and SUNY Empire State College</p>

The Millbrook Hunt is one of the most attractive hunts in the United States, and their hunt country is perhaps the most beautiful open land anywhere in the world. Knowing this, and wanting to continue in the manner of artists who have used the Hunt as their subject matter, Kathy Landman spent a year on foot following the hunt. Beginning in the early fall with roading the young hounds, through late winter, when the pack working in concert like a finely tuned orchestra, would raise their voices in full cry, Landman witnessed many moments of beauty and inspiration for this, her first series of prints on the Millbrook Hunt.</p>
<p>Landman’s  artistic process is both photographic and painterly. Kathy combines pictures and drawings into seamless photo realistic images which she prints on her press using archival pigments and Hanemuhle German Etching Paper. Each of the large prints in this series is signed, numbered and embossed and limited to an edition of ten. The complete set of 12 prints is available as a boxed set, or can be ordered individually.
